2

com.google.android.maps.*アンドロイド用のグーグルマップAPIを試していますが、eclipseはファイルをインポートしません。

ソース:

MyMapActivity:

package org.madmax.map;

import android.app.Activity;
import android.os.Bundle;
import com.google.android.maps.*;

public class MyMapActivity extends MapActivity {
    private MapView map;
    private MapController controller;

    /** Called when the activity is first created. */
    @Override
    public void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);
        setContentView(R.layout.main);
    }
}

私がすでに宣言したマニフェストファイルで:

 <uses-library android:name="com.google.android.maps" />

com.google.android.maps.*ファイルをインポートするにはどうすればよいですか?

4

2 に答える 2

15

APISDKをインストールするだけでは不十分です。アンドロイドマップのドキュメントから、

http://code.google.com/android/add-ons/google-apis/maps-overview.html

マップを既存のアプリケーションに追加する場合は、パッケージエクスプローラーでプロジェクトを右クリックし、[プロパティ]> [Android]を選択して、表示されたリストからビルドターゲットを選択します。「GoogleAPI」ビルドターゲットを選択する必要があります。

(標準のAndroidパッケージにはGoogleマップは含まれていません)

更新し、オンラインでスクリーンショットを見つけました。「Androidxx」という名前のターゲットを選択しないでください。必要なバージョンのAndroidに対応する「GoogleAPI」というターゲットを選択してください。

ここに画像の説明を入力してください

于 2012-04-12T21:55:51.493 に答える
2

SDKにGoogleAPIがインストールされていることを確認してください。ディレクトリからSDKマネージャーを開き、toolsそれを使用してパッケージをインストールします。

于 2012-04-12T21:32:08.307 に答える